Federal Reserve Rate Decisions and Their Impact on CHZ Price Volatility in 2026

The Federal Reserve's January 2026 decision to maintain interest rates between 3.5% and 3.75% established the baseline for CHZ price dynamics throughout the year. This measured approach reflects the central bank's cautious outlook, with the FOMC signaling no immediate rate changes despite improving growth indicators. For CHZ traders, these Federal Reserve rate decisions create a critical framework for understanding price volatility patterns.

Monetary policy shifts directly influence CHZ price movements by affecting broader market risk appetite and capital allocation. When the Fed holds rates steady, investors reassess growth-oriented assets, including digital tokens tied to emerging technologies. CHZ's moderate volatility during this period reflects this reassessment process, with the token trading within a defined range while maintaining robust 24-hour trading volume. The FOMC's scheduled meetings throughout 2026—March, April, June, July, and September—serve as key catalysts for price volatility spikes, as market participants anticipate potential rate adjustments based on incoming economic data.

The consistency of Federal Reserve communications shapes market expectations about future monetary conditions. CHZ's strong liquidity and active trading volume demonstrate that investors closely monitor rate decision announcements and policy statements, adjusting positions ahead of FOMC meetings. This dynamic creates predictable volatility windows where CHZ price movements become more pronounced as traders react to rate guidance and inflation data releases.

CPI data serves as a critical transmission mechanism linking macroeconomic conditions to cryptocurrency demand and pricing. When inflation data trends lower than expected, market participants interpret this as signaling potential Federal Reserve rate cuts, which fundamentally reshapes investor asset allocation strategies. This inflation data interpretation triggers a cascading shift in capital flows as risk-on sentiment strengthens, prompting institutional and retail investors to reallocate holdings from traditional markets toward higher-yielding digital assets. The mechanism operates through increased system liquidity that typically accompanies Fed policy accommodation, making speculative crypto assets more attractive relative to conventional stocks and bonds. Historical analysis reveals that lower-than-expected CPI readings correlate with heightened fund inflows into cryptocurrency markets, including altcoins like CHZ, as investors seek diversification and inflation hedges beyond traditional equities and commodities. This asset reallocation intensifies during periods of monetary easing, when the opportunity cost of holding non-yielding crypto assets diminishes. Market participants monitoring CPI trends in 2026 recognize that inflation data transmission directly influences how capital flows between traditional markets and digital assets, making CHZ's price performance increasingly sensitive to macroeconomic expectations and Fed policy signals embedded within CPI announcements.

Risk-Off Market Dynamics: S&P 500 Corrections and Gold Price Movements as Leading Indicators for CHZ Downside Pressure

When equity markets face downside pressure, broader market sentiment shifts toward defensive positioning, creating conditions where alternative assets like CHZ become particularly vulnerable. The S&P 500's historical correction patterns reveal that markets routinely experience 10-20% declines from recent peaks, and these episodes often coincide with elevated risk aversion across asset classes. During such periods, gold tends to rally as investors seek safe-haven exposure, a classic risk-off signal that has historically preceded or accompanied crypto sell-offs.

The relationship between these macro indicators and CHZ price movements proves more nuanced than simple correlation. Data from 2020-2026 shows that while S&P 500 corrections and CHZ volatility episodes don't follow a strict lead-lag pattern, risk-off environments characterized by equity weakness, gold strength, and U.S. dollar appreciation do tend to amplify downside pressure on crypto holdings. During geopolitical uncertainty or inflation concerns—periods when central bank policy uncertainty peaks—these cross-asset dynamics intensify. Gold's repricing of macro risk, combined with equity market volatility, creates a broader sentiment backdrop that disadvantages speculative assets. CHZ, as a mid-cap cryptocurrency with exposure to discretionary spending trends, responds to this macro risk rotation by experiencing sustained sell pressure when institutional investors simultaneously reduce equity exposure and rebalance toward traditional hedges.

FAQ

How do Federal Reserve policy changes directly affect CHZ token price?

Federal Reserve policy changes impact CHZ price indirectly through USD strength and market sentiment. Tighter policy strengthens USD and may pressure CHZ lower, while looser policy boosts risk appetite and supports CHZ upside. Inflation data influences rate expectations, driving crypto market dynamics.

What is the correlation between 2026 inflation data and CHZ price movements?

2026 inflation data shows minimal direct correlation with CHZ price movements. CHZ price fluctuations are primarily driven by market sentiment, trading volume, and blockchain adoption rather than macroeconomic inflation indicators.

How do Federal Reserve rate hikes or cuts specifically affect CHZ and other cryptocurrencies?

Fed rate hikes increase borrowing costs, directing capital toward traditional assets and reducing crypto demand, typically depressing CHZ prices. Conversely, rate cuts lower borrowing costs, encouraging risk-on investment flows into cryptocurrencies like CHZ, potentially boosting prices as investors seek higher yields.

In a high inflation environment, how does CHZ perform as a safe-haven asset?

CHZ demonstrates limited safe-haven characteristics during high inflation periods. As inflation rises, traditional risk-off assets like bonds and treasury yields become more attractive, which may redirect capital away from crypto assets like CHZ. However, some investors view CHZ as an inflation hedge due to its supply constraints and blockchain utility properties. Overall, CHZ's performance depends on broader market sentiment and macroeconomic conditions rather than serving as a primary inflation hedge.
